With this service option, we can eliminate the problem of customers <br />abusing the system by overstuffing their 32-gallon container. This option will <br />also offer the 90-gallon container customers a chance to change to a smaller <br />container if they are good at recycling and don't need such a large container. <br /> <br />. <br /> <br />Additionally, effective January 1, 2000, recycling pick-up will change from a <br />biweekly to a weekly service. With the weekly service, customers will no <br />longer have to try to remember which week they should set their recycling <br />bin out and their recyclables will not pile up. This convenience should <br />encourage more people to recycle. <br /> <br />Staff recommends reduced customer charges for refuse collection effective <br />January 1, 2000. Due to an existing fund surplus, the new county payment <br />of $20.00 per household to the city (for providing an organized refuse and <br />recycling program and for requiring waste disposal at the RDF plant), and <br />the new wages in the hauler contracts, we are able to lower the prices. After <br />surveying surrounding communities, we found that adding a 60 gallon <br />container option, weekly recycling, and the new lower customer prices for <br />garbage service will make our services and pricing equivalent to households <br />throughout the school district and county. <br /> <br />. <br /> <br />13065 Orono Parkway · P.O.
